When director Edward Hall and his all-male Propeller company from Great Britain hit the stage, be ready for fireworksas witnessed by ecstatic audiences when Hall's Rose Rage (a condensed but thrilling double-helping of Shakespeare's Henry VI trilogy) recently took New York by storm. This extraordinary ensemble makes their Bay Area debut at Cal Performances in Hall's haunting new production of Shakespeare's The Winter's Tale. In this timeless story, a man consumed by an inexplicable jealousy destroys everything around himhis family, his kingdom, and himself. Wracked by guilt, he sets off a chain reaction of events leading to a miraculous conclusion and the possibility for reconciliation.
